  • Using the GUI to add bold characters to my name in a recent SVN build sometimes fails, resulting in my name getting truncated. For instance, ^5WorkaPhobia, where the W and P are bold and the rest are normal characters, results in a name of ^5, which displays as two double quotes, the second of which is colored. I think this isn't specific to the menu, but happens on the console level as well (so it is probably an issue with older clients as well, but I haven't tested it). I can set my name by (hex)editting the _cl_name entry in my config file, but creating an alias in my autoexec to do this manually from the console after start doesn't work.

    Has anyone else had problems using bold characters in combination with normal ones?

  • The bug is that DP cuts off lines with a special character in them, if that character isn't quoted. IIRC this behaviour is intentional, to prevent weird behaviour these characters may cause.

    The menu executed

    name $_cl_name

    to send the new name to the server, but it SHOULD have used

    name "$_cl_name"
